Full Description
[TR 15883400] The Martello Tower (NR) (1) Now a private dwelling "The Martello Tower". (2) TR 159340. Martello 13 built in 1805 and still surviving. (3) At the western end of West parade, Hythe, this tower was spared when the others were destroyed. It was sold by the War Department in 1906, and has been a dwelling since 1928, when a builder, A J Glock whose ambition it was to live in a martello, carried out altrations and named it Place Forte. It was bought in 1937 by Edgar Wheeler. At the outbreak of World War II it was requisitioned and become an observation post for the coast artillery for shelling the French coast. The present owner, Mr Ronald Ward, has since carried out a complete conversion. It is now known simply and properly as the Martello tower. (4)
The slightly elliptical, brick-built tower, was constructed on three levels, with no surrounding moat or associated earthwork. It stands to its original height of around 10m. Numerous alterations and additions have been made, including the construction of a single storey observation post on the roof when the tower was requisitioned during World War II. A 24-pounder gun and gun carriage, possibly the original items, lie in the front garden of the tower. The historic fabric and visual amenity of the tower has been compromised by its conversion to a dwelling, which includes the insertion of numerous, large windows and the construction of a surrounding wall. Scheduling is not recommended. (5-7)
